I have unzipped my files but
I still can't open them!
Many of our ZIP files (except Fashion Illustrations) contain files in DesignaKnit
format, so you will need this program to be able to use the download. Unzip the
files first, then:
*
For shapes, open DesignaKnit, then open Original Shaping, then File > Open
and browse for the folder that contains the unzipped files. Click on the .shp
file you want and it will open in Original Shaping.
*
For stitch patterns, open DesignaKnit, then open Stitch Designer, then File >
Open and browse for the files as before. Click on the .pat or .stp file you want
and it will open in Stitch Designer.
* Any PDF files included in the download will need to be opened in Adobe
Acrobat Reader version 5 or better. Adobe Acrobat Reader is available as a free
download from http://www.adobe.com.
* Any TIF files included in the download will need to be opened in a graphics
program such as Paint Shop Pro, Photoshop, or similar.

SPECIAL INSTALLATION INSTRUCTIONS FOR KNITWARE DESIGN
SOFTWARE
STEP 1: Extract and Unzip the files:
1. Using Windows Explorer, find the downloaded file (basics250.exe, sweaters250.exe,
or skirts250.exe).
2. If the downloaded file is on your Windows desktop, copy it to a new folder.
3. With Windows Explorer showing the folder with the downloaded file, double-click
on the downloaded file.
The self-extracting unzipping program automatically runs to extract the installation
files. Eleven (11) files are extracted, one of which is named setup.exe.
This file is the installer launch program for the Knitware program.
STEP 2: Install the Knitware program:
1. Close all programs that are running, except Windows Explorer.
2. In the Windows Explorer, check that you can see the setup.exe file.
3. Double-click on setup.exe.
4. Click OK to start the install.
Click through the installation screens, accepting the suggested default
values. Your Knitware program is installed, and you can later access it from the
Start > Programs menu. If you are using Windows Vista, you will need to set
Administrator privileges and be in Compatibility Mode before you run the program;
please continue with the instructions below.
Known
problem with Knitware programs
and Windows Vista
After installing any of the Knitware programs on Windows Vista, you will see this
error message when you try to run the program:
Network initialization failed
Permission denied
File C:/PDOXUSRS.net
The Solution:
In the Start > Programs menu, find the menu item for your Knitware program.
It will look similar to this:

Right-click the menu item to display the Properties box for your program and do
the following:
1. Click the Compatibility tab.
2. Select the compatibility mode for Windows XP.
3. Check the box to run the program as an administrator.
4. Leave all other settings unchanged or unchecked. The image below shows all
the settings entered correctly.
5. When you save the new properties, you should be able to run the program successfully
from this point forward. Once the program starts up successfully, you can enter
the serial number to enable full program mode.
Once you set the compatibility mode for your Knitware program, you will
not have to do anything more to run the program. However, if you uninstall and
re-install Knitware, you will have to repeat this procedure. If you use more than
one Knitware program, you will have to set compatibility mode for each of your
programs.
